Reach4thealps is an established and successful Chalet Company based in Morzine, run by Gina and Marcus Ewart.  We are both very keen skiers and bikers and love Morzine & this area. We are passionate about delivering great holidays through excellent customer service.

We set up Reach4thealps in 2002 and we currently have a portfolio of 5 catered (winter only) and 15 self-catered properties in the Morzine & Les Gets area. All the chalets are of a high standard but what ensures our repeat rate stays high is the level of customer service and high standard of catering we offer along with the help of our staff, which is why we need to continue to have motivated, capable and happy staff.

Guest Services & Bookings Coordinator

We are looking for an enthusiastic and reliable individual to join the Reach4TheAlps team as a key year-round member of our office. You will work closely with Gina and Marcus, the business owners, Jo, our Operations Manager, and Adam, who manages transfers and maintenance and of course our resort team.

This role focuses on handling enquiries, managing bookings, and providing administrative and operational support.

Responsibilities

Enquiries & Guest Communication

  • Respond promptly to email and phone enquiries.
  • Keep property availability updated on our website and partner platforms.
  • Develop in-depth knowledge of our chalets, the resort, and the services we offer.
  • Suggest ideas to improve marketing and sales strategies.
  • Design newsletters to engage guests.

Bookings Management

  • Update and manage guest details in our booking system.
  • Handle agency enquiries.
  • Assist guests with existing bookings, including lift passes, transfers, and dietary requirements.

Website & Social Media Admin

  • Refresh website content with weekly blogs and news items.
  • Update pricing and promotions across our website and agency platforms.
  • Promote Reach4TheAlps on social media to drive traffic to our website.

Operational Support

  • Ensure guests receive accurate arrival instructions.
  • Process lift passes online.
  • Provide hands-on support when needed, such as helping out on busy changeover days with meeting guests, picking up linen, checking hot tubs, clearing snow, and delivering lift passes.

Key Attributes

  • Attention to Detail: Accuracy in managing bookings and guest requirements.
  • Positive Attitude: Enthusiastic, reliable, and professional.
  • Customer Focus: Genuine interest in delivering exceptional service.
  • Team Player: Supportive, proactive and flexible.
  • Highly Organised: Able to prioritise and stay on top of tasks.

Key Skills

  • Strong computer skills (Google Drive, photo editing, WordPress).
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ills.
  • Numeracy skills for calculating pricing adjustments.
  • Ability to stay calm under pressure.

Qualifications & Experience

  • Office experience, ideally in sales, marketing, or the ski industry.
  • Experience in digital marketing.

Salary & Benefits

  • Competitive package tailored to experience.
  • French contract (seasonal initially, with the option to move to full-time).

Hours

  • Winter: 5 days a week, including at least one weekend day. Split shifts available for mountain time.
  • Rest of the Year: 4 days a week.

Summer Crew Housekeeping Role

 Join Our Team for a Season of Adventure !

Are you passionate about creating welcoming environments and keen on spending an unforgettable summer in the heart of the breathtaking Morzine? We’re on the hunt for enthusiastic individuals to become a vital part of our team this summer! Whether you’re already a Morzine local or dreaming of a summer filled with mountain air and vibrant community life, we’ve got the perfect part-time housekeeping role for you!

This isn’t just any job; it’s your ticket to a summer packed with new experiences, all while working an average of 18 hours a week from the beginning of June to mid-September.

Here’s What Makes This Opportunity Shine:

  • Work Hard Play Hard: Most of your 18-hour work week will be during the weekends (about 12-14 hours), with 4-6 hours mid week for those mid-week refreshes or changeovers.
  • Diverse and Dynamic Role: From deep cleaning to making beds, managing linen returns, stocking up on cleaning supplies, and being the warm welcome that greets our guests – your role is key to our success and our guests’ happiness.
  • Be the Heartbeat of Our Properties: You’re not just tidying up; you’re the go-to for guest offering advice on the best spots and activities in Morzine, and ensuring they have all they need for a memorable stay.
  • Knowledge is Power: Get to know the ins and outs of our properties, from operating appliances to troubleshooting, ensuring a comfortable and hassle-free stay for all guests.
  • Team Collaboration: Plan and coordinate your cleaning schedule effectively with the rest of the team, ensuring seamless guest transitions and the highest standards of hospitality.

This role is perfect for those who love to blend meticulous attention to detail with genuine guest interaction, all set against the stunning backdrop of Morzine’s summer season. Ready to make this summer one for the books while developing invaluable skills in hospitality and service? Let’s make it happen together!

Embrace the Adventure with Us in Morzine

Package:

  • For those who don’t live here we can offer shared accommodation and a monthly salary paid through the French system.
  • If you have a car and use it for work, you’ll be recompensed accordingly
  • For micro entrepreneur’s hourly wage is €20-€25 an hour depending on experience and number of hours.
  • Team events during the season

Looking for presentable, trustworthy, reliable, hardworking considerate candidates who have cleaning/housekeeping experience and have a nice, friendly, enthusiastic but professional manner for welcoming guests and helping them with any queries and who can use their initiative to organise themselves so that the cleaning gets done thoroughly but quickly.

Looking for candidates with  relevant work experience and who are happy working as part of team to share out work and pull together when necessary.
